#b4d0b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4d0b8 is composed of 70.6% red, 81.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 23% and a lightness of 76.1%. #b4d0b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69a171.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#b4d0b8 color description : Grayish lime green.
#b4d0b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4d0b8 has RGB values of R:180, G:208,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 11849912.

Shades and Tints of #b4d0b8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060906 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4d0b8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dc7bf is the less saturated color, while #85ff96 is the most saturated one.
